What safety practices govern training engagements?

Explanation:
In training engagements, safety hinges on operating in a controlled, prepared environment with the right resources and procedures in place. Using authorized ranges creates a defined, supervised space with established safety controls, clear lines of communication, and assured backstops so activities stay within safe boundaries. Having medical and security support means there’s immediate aid available for any injuries or incidents and rapid protection if a security issue arises, which is essential for real-world readiness. Proper training devices ensure that the practice tools are appropriate for learning the skills without introducing unnecessary hazards, often using simulators or inert equipment. Adhering to safety standard operating procedures at all times keeps everyone on the same page with risk assessments, PPE use, task checklists, and incident reporting, reducing the chance of accidents and ensuring consistent safety practices.
